Subject: Second-Source Supplier Search — Update

Team, following the Mosswood supply disruption, procurement has shortlisted three alternative fabricators for the Calder valve assembly. Site audits begin next month; qualification should complete by Q2. Please keep customer commitments conservative until dual sourcing is confirmed. One confidential note on our plans appears below.

internal memo for kawip-hadug: Headcount on the Wenwyn team goes from 7 to 140 by the end of January. Gross margin on Wenwyn came in at 20 percent against a plan of 15 percent.

## 4.2.0 — Changed defaults: webhook retry semantics

Heads up for the release notes: Hooklark now retries failed webhook deliveries with exponential backoff instead of the old fixed 30-second loop. Max attempts dropped from 10 to 6, but the total retry window actually got longer (about 2 hours). Consumers who relied on fast hammering will notice slower redelivery — that's intentional. Nothing needed from tenants unless they've overridden retry settings. The new shipping defaults are as follows.

service settings:
PRAIX_LOG_LEVEL=error
PRAIX_METRICS_HOST=metrics.praix.qorvelcorp.corp
PRAIX_POOL_SIZE=16

If devices subscribed through your plugin stop receiving updates from the Hollowpine firmware channel, first check that the channel manifest has not been pinned to a retired release. Next, confirm your plugin's subscription record via GET /channels/hollowpine/subscriptions; a 404 means re-registration is required. Registration and manifest queries both require authenticated requests against the sandbox gateway. For sandbox testing, authenticate your calls with the bearer token shown below.

portal login ticket: eyJhbGciOiJIUzI1NiIsInR5cCI6IkpXVCJ9.eyJzdWIiOiIMjvRAf3PEFIn0.nuv9gjixLtnr